Aldine Independent School District is a school district based in an unincorporated Harris County, Texas, United States. It serves portions of Houston and unincorporated Harris County. AISD is part of the taxation base for the Lone Star College System.

KIPP NYC is a network of free public charter schools located in the Bronx, Brooklyn, and Manhattan, dedicated to empowering students from elementary through high school. The organization partners with families and communities to equip every child with the skills necessary for success in college, career, and beyond. KIPP NYC emphasizes rigorous academics, character development, and personalized support to help students make a positive impact in their communities. With a commitment to educational excellence, KIPP NYC has been serving students for over 30 years, fostering a future without limits.
